Tauranga Regional Multicultural Council Inc. (TRMC) is an incorporated society managed by a committed group of volunteers who have a desire to promote and protect the interest of ethnic groups which make up New Zealand's multicultural society. Any ethnic group, society, organisation or individual is welcome to become a member of TRMC.
We have several activities during the year, amongst which are the annual Tauranga Regional Ethnic Festival, and the monthly Living in Harmony. The Regional Ethnic Festival brings together a compilation of culture, dance, food, arts and crafts to encourage and introduce the over seventy migrant communities living in Tauranga to the wider community.
